Hi All,
if I use hotmail in firefox, the spell checker facility doesn't seem to work.
When I click on the spellchecker tab, all I get is a dialogue box saying
" Youre using a web browser that checks spelling automatically"

I typed in mis-spelled words on purpose to see if any were highlighted by a red squiggley line, but none were shown to be mis-spelt

Is there an add on or something else that I need..

thanks in advance

"Try right clicking any word" in the reply box . . . . that's your spell check!

You don't need, and don't have spell checkers in forums as a rule.

The Firefox browser has it's own.
Should you have misspelt words in a forum reply box, it should, but not always, have a red line underneath telling you it's spelt wrong according to it's dictionary, or it doesn't recognise the word.
You right click an underlined word, and you will have options to use that it thinks is the correct word. Click a word it suggests and it changes the misspelt word.

If as I said above, if you have no United Kingdom showing and ticked, click 'Add Dictionaries', then scroll down to English (British) and install (Add to Firefox).
Restart the browser.

I don't normally use Hotmail to write messages, but I've just tried the spell checker in Hotmail and I get the same message as you do.

In Firefox, go to Tools>Options>Advanced>General tab and, under 'Browsing', make sure that 'Check my spelling as I type' has a tick by it. This should give you the red line under a misspelt word. You can then right click on it and select the right word from the list given.

If you want a separate spell checker, have a look at SpellBound 3.0.6 which works well with Firefox 3xx, up to and including the current version, 3.5.3. I have it and use it a lot.

Either way, you need the British English Dictionary as mentioned above. You may already have it, so check your Add-ons (Extensions part) to see if it's there. If not, you can get it here.
